Add 25/16 and 98/9
1st number: 1 9/16, 2nd number: 10 8/9
25/16 + 98/9 is 1793/144.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 16 and 9 is 144
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 144 - For the 1st fraction, since 16 × 9 = 144,
25/16 = 25 × 9/16 × 9 = 225/144 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 9 × 16 = 144,
98/9 = 98 × 16/9 × 16 = 1568/144 - Add the two like fractions:
225/144 + 1568/144 = 225 + 1568/144 = 1793/144 - So, 25/16 + 98/9 = 1793/144
